Saturday afternoon, I sat in for Garrett Stack on his program American Jukebox, rock and pop hits of the ’50s, ’60s, and ’70s. So I thought I’d spend Saturday evening on my show playing jazz versions of pop tunes. I gave the Gershwins, Rogers and Hart, Jerome Kern, Dorothy Fields, etc. the night off. They didn’t complain, probably for reasons of death.
